Sumérgete en 'Música para camaleones', una obra maestra de Truman Capote que fusiona la literatura documental con la poesía y el horror de la vida. Este libro, dividido en tres partes, te lleva desde piezas cortas y magistrales hasta una novela corta escalofriante y conversaciones reveladoras con personajes inolvidables, incluyendo a Marilyn Monroe y un autorretrato desgarrador del propio Capote. Descubre la prosa sencilla y límpida que Capote buscó para comunicar directamente con el lector, convirtiéndote en testigo de experiencias verdaderas y subyugantes.

Truman Garcia Capote was an American novelist, screenwriter, playwright, and actor. Several of his short stories, novels, and plays have been praised as literary classics, and he is regarded as one of the founders of New Journalism, along with Gay Talese, Hunter S. Thompson, Norman Mailer, Joan Didion, and Tom Wolfe. His work and his life story have been adapted into and have been the subject of more than 20 films and television productions.
